What Is a Z-Wave Home Security System and How Does It Work?

A Z-Wave home security system is a wireless communication protocol designed for home automation that enables devices to connect and communicate with one another. It is particularly used for creating smart home networks that include security devices such as cameras, sensors, and alarms. Z-Wave technology operates on a low-energy frequency, allowing devices to maintain a reliable connection while conserving battery life.

According to the Z-Wave Alliance, Z-Wave technology is widely recognized for its interoperability among various manufacturers, making it a popular choice for smart home systems (Z-Wave Alliance, 2023). This standardization allows users to mix and match devices from different brands, all of which can be controlled through a single hub or application.

Key aspects of Z-Wave home security systems include their mesh networking capability, which allows devices to communicate with each other over longer distances by relaying signals through intermediate devices. This enhances the reliability of the system, as devices can remain connected even if they are far from the central hub. Additionally, Z-Wave devices typically operate on the sub-1 GHz frequency band, which minimizes interference from Wi-Fi and other household devices. This results in a more stable and secure connection, crucial for effective home security.

How Does Z-Wave Technology Enhance Home Automation and Security?

Z-Wave technology significantly improves home automation and security through its reliable and efficient wireless communication protocol.

  • Interconnectivity: Z-Wave devices can seamlessly communicate with one another, allowing for a more cohesive smart home ecosystem. This interconnectivity ensures that various devices such as locks, sensors, and cameras can work together, enhancing the overall security and automation of the home.
  • Low Power Consumption: Z-Wave technology is designed for low power usage, which is ideal for battery-operated devices such as door sensors and motion detectors. This efficiency means that devices can operate for extended periods without frequent battery replacements, maintaining continuous security without interruption.
  • Mesh Networking: Z-Wave utilizes a mesh network topology, enabling devices to relay information to each other. This means that even if a device is out of range from the central hub, it can communicate through other nearby Z-Wave devices, ensuring robust coverage throughout the home.
  • Enhanced Security Features: Z-Wave technology includes built-in security protocols that protect against hacking and unauthorized access. With features like AES-128 encryption, users can feel confident that their home automation system is secure from external threats.
  • Ease of Integration: Many of the best Z-Wave home security systems are designed to integrate effortlessly with existing home automation setups. This compatibility allows homeowners to enhance their security without the need for extensive rewiring or disruption to their current systems.
  • Remote Access and Control: Z-Wave enables users to control their home security devices remotely via smartphone apps. This feature allows homeowners to monitor their property in real-time, receive alerts, and make adjustments to their security settings from anywhere, adding an extra layer of convenience and peace of mind.

What Are the Advantages of Choosing a Z-Wave Home Security System Over Others?

The advantages of choosing a Z-Wave home security system over others include enhanced interoperability, low power consumption, and reliable communication.

  • Interoperability: Z-Wave technology allows devices from different manufacturers to work seamlessly together, meaning homeowners can mix and match components to create a customized security solution. This flexibility is particularly beneficial for those looking to expand their systems over time without being locked into a single brand.
  • Low Power Consumption: Z-Wave devices are designed to consume very little power, which not only extends the battery life of wireless sensors but also reduces overall energy costs. This efficiency is especially advantageous for battery-operated devices, ensuring they remain operational for extended periods without frequent replacements.
  • Reliable Communication: Z-Wave operates on a unique low-frequency radio signal that is less prone to interference from Wi-Fi and other household devices. This results in a more stable and dependable connection between devices, providing peace of mind that your security system will function effectively when needed most.
